Bonney Lake quadruplets celebrate first birthdayBy Associated Press
TACOMA, Wash. (AP) - A Bonney Lake couple is celebrating their quadruplets' first birthday this weekend.
Lesley and Guy Culley say their kids have been relatively easy babies but that doesn't mean it's easy to take care of four babies. The quads are active and crawl everywhere and soon will be walking. It's also been a challenge for Guy, the family's sole wage-earner, to keep up with expenses. He says the family of eight is moving to a smaller, less expensive home, to make things easier. Their brood includes two children from previous relationships: 7-year-old Brent and 6-year-old Meg. The family celebrated the quadruplets' first birthday a day early because more people could attend the party on a Saturday. The babies, who were born about two months early, are all healthy. |
